Description: Koa is a popular open source web application framework for Node.js that uses modern JavaScript features to serve scalable web apps. It provides a minimalist approach, rich middleware, and a key focus on error handling to build efficient and robust apps.

Description: Willer Framework is an open-source front-end framework for developing flexible, scalable websites and web applications. It provides a modular, component-based architecture for building user interfaces using HTML, CSS, and JavaScript.
